Advisory Board
SoupMobile, Inc. Advisory Council was created to help the SoupMobile manage its rapid growth. Advisory Council members provide:
- Professional advice and counsel as the executive director, staff, and volunteers execute the SoupMobile’s near-term strategic plan
- Guide goal-setting and help with the development of the SoupMobile three-year strategic plan
- Access to new funding opportunities and program resources
Lon Ricker
Chairman
Lon was born and raised in Michigan, moved to the Chicago area after college and relocated to Texas in the 90’s. After 20 years climbing the corporate ladder in the telecommunications industry, Lon decided that there was more to life than working for a paycheck. His desire to make a positive difference in the world led him to the Christmas Angel Project in 2007. As a result, he has been a regular volunteer at the SoupMobile in varying capacities, and looks forward to spearheading the grant writing program as well as the Christmas Angel Project for 2009.
In his spare time, Lon enjoys riding motorcycles, traveling and listening to blues music (and especially enjoys traveling on his motorcycle to blues music events).
His favorite soup is the wide noodle, chicken noodle soup that his mom makes, but Chef Gene’s Wednesday Spaghetti runs a very close second.

Linda Graf
Social Media Coordinator
Linda was born and raised in Kalamazoo, MI. After graduating from high school, she worked where she met and married Rick, her husband of 27 years. Linda thought she’d start a family instead of going to college and was very successful, having 4 children in 5 years. She moved to Dallas in 1982, just before their first child was born. She spent the next 25 years raising their four wonderful blessings.
She did forget one thing, that as soon as children come into the house they leave the house so back to work she went. After working full time for three years she decided flexibility would be a wonderful thing. She found the SoupMobile on-line and the rest is history.
Linda loves to bake, read, and travel and has more interests than can be listed. She is currently using her office and organizational skills and is enjoying her new social life as well, meeting so many really nice people week after week.
Her favorite soup is her own broccoli cheese soup.

LeAnne Baird

Donations, Community Fundraising and Grant Writing
LeAnne hails from Nebraska and moved to Dallas in 1980. That wouldn't normally make her a native Dallas resident, except that that’s about average in her North Dallas neighborhood.
She attended college in Lincoln, Nebraska, where she earned her undergraduate degree in Folklore. Following her BA degree, LeAnne undertook Masters coursework and did extensive research in Historical Geography and Architecture History.
She owns a condo, has been married 30 years to an extraordinary man named Ron, and is kept company by a darling miniature poodle.
In her spare time, LeAnne enjoys reading mystery novels and collecting materials to make jewelry. In addition, she loves to cook … but only now and then, when the refrigerator has food in it.
As a valued member of the team, LeAnne's peaceful presence creates the tone for each new day.
Her favorite soup is Homemade Tomato Vegetable.

Rusty Kennard
Rusty Kennard received a B.S. degree from Baylor University in 1977 and law degree from SMU in 1988. Practiced litigation for 10 years, mainly from the plaintiff's side. Co-founder of a financial services company in 1992 that was merged into a NYSE company in 1997. Thereafter, joined a software development/patent creation firm and has been CEO of that entity for the past few years.
He is married to Betsy, his college sweetheart, for 26 years. They have 3 kids: Kate, Elizabeth, and Will. Rusty enjoys bicycling, yoga, painting, and mission work—particularly building. His friends and family know him as a hard working, fun loving, and deeply spiritual individual.
His favorite soup is homemade Chicken Tortilla Soup with chips, avocados and plenty of Picante sauce.

Mariana Griggs
Mariana Griggs is a native of Texas. She attended St. Edward’s University in Austin, Texas where she received a B.A. in Business Management. After brief employment in the business world Mrs. Griggs attended Texas A&M University where she attained an M.S. in Entomology. Currently, Mariana is a Science teacher at Bishop Dunne Catholic School in Dallas, Texas.
Mariana’s volunteer activities include work with the Soupmobile, Crossroads Community Services and Community Gardens of Oak Cliff. Through these organizations she hopes to provide assistance and love to those in need.
Her favorite soup is Loaded Baked Potato.
